NEW QUESTION # 70
The_________________ensures that a project transitioning into implementation also smoothly transitions into appropriate Architecture Governance.
- A. Migration Plan
- B. Implementation Strategy
- C. Implementation Governance Model
- D. Transition Plan
Answer: C
Explanation:
The Implementation Governance Model is a framework that defines the roles, responsibilities, processes, and standards for governing the implementation of the target architecture. It ensures that a project transitioning into implementation also smoothly transitions into appropriate Architecture Governance, which is the practice of ensuring compliance with the enterprise architecture and its principles, standards, and goals. The Implementation Governance Model is part of the Implementation and Migration Plan, which is the output of Phase F: Migration Planning of the Architecture Development Method (ADM)12 Reference: 1: The TOGAF Standard, Version 9.2, Part II: Architecture Development Method (ADM), Chapter 21: Phase F: Migration Planning 2: The TOGAF Standard, Version 9.2, Part VI: Architecture Capability Framework, Chapter 50: Architecture Governance
NEW QUESTION # 71
Which of the following describes the practice by which the enterprise architecture is managed and controlled at an enterprise-wide level?
- A. Architecture governance
- B. IT governance
- C. Corporate governance
- D. Technology governance
Answer: A
Explanation:
According to the TOGAF Standard, 10th Edition, architecture governance is "the practice by which enterprise architectures and other architectures are managed and controlled at an enterprise-wide level" 1. Architecture governance ensures that the architecture development and implementation are aligned with the strategic objectives, principles, standards, and requirements of the enterprise, and that they deliver the expected value and outcomes. Architecture governance also involves establishing and maintaining the architecture framework, repository, board, contracts, and compliance reviews 1. The other options are not correct, as they are not the term used by the TOGAF Standard to describe the practice by which the enterprise architecture is managed and controlled at an enterprise-wide level. Corporate governance is "the system by which an organization is directed and controlled" 2, and it covers aspects such as leadership, strategy, performance, accountability, and ethics. IT governance is "the system by which the current and future use of IT is directed and controlled" 2, and it covers aspects such as IT strategy, policies, standards, and services. Technology governance is "the system by which the technology decisions and investments are directed and controlled" 3, and it covers aspects such as technology selection, acquisition, deployment, and maintenance. NEW QUESTION # 73
Which one of the following classes of information within the Architecture Repository would typically contain a list of the applications in use within the enterprise?
- A. Governance Log
- B. Architecture Landscape
- C. Reference Library
- D. Architecture Metamodel
Answer: B
Explanation:
The Architecture Landscape is a class of information within the Architecture Repository that shows an architectural view of the building blocks that are in use within the organization today (the Baseline Architecture), as well as those that are planned for the future (the Target Architecture). The Architecture Landscape typically contains a list of the applications in use within the enterprise, along with their relationships and dependencies, as well as other relevant architectural information. The Architecture Landscape helps to identify opportunities for re-use, consolidation, or retirement of existing applications, as well as gaps or overlaps in the current or future architecture.Reference: : The TOGAF Standard, Version 9.2, Part IV: Architecture Content Framework, Chapter 34: Architecture Landscape : The TOGAF Standard, Version 9.2, Part VI: Architecture Capability Framework, Chapter 47: Architecture Repository
NEW QUESTION # 74
Which of the following is a responsibility of an Architecture Board?
- A. Conducting assessments of the maturity level of architecture discipline within the organization
- B. Establishing targets for re-use of components
- C. Creating the Statement of Architecture Work
- D. Allocating resources for architecture projects
Answer: B
Explanation:
* An Architecture Board is an executive-level group responsible for the review and maintenance of the strategic architecture and all of its sub-architectures1. It is a key element in a successful Architecture Governance strategy2.
* An Architecture Board is typically made responsible, and accountable, for achieving some or all of the following goals2:
* Providing the basis for all decision-making with regard to the architectures
* Consistency between sub-architectures
* Establishing targets for re-use of components
* Flexibility of the Enterprise Architecture: To meet changing business needs To leverage new technologies
* Enforcement of Architecture Compliance
* Improving the maturity level of architecture discipline within the organization
* Ensuring that the discipline of architecture-based development is adopted
* Supporting a visible escalation capability for out-of-bounds decisions
